The Galya Baluvan chain is expanding its presence by introducing itself to the American market under the name Multi Cook

The Galya Baluvana chain from Ukraine is entering the American market under the name Multi Cook, reported Volodymyr Matviychuk, the owner of the company. The first store was opened in Philadelphia.

"Now you will have the opportunity to taste unparalleled Ukrainian dishes, such as dumplings, pelmeni, chebureks and many others," he wrote.

At the beginning of its history, Galya Baluvana successfully covered the Ukrainian market under the terms of a franchise, and now it is expanding its activities to the American market under the new name Multi Cook.
